Background technique
Currently, the Chinese patent that notification number is CN103548644B discloses a kind of vertical greening wall, including it is layed in wall Support curtain and be set to support curtain packing bag, the packing bag include hard plate, connection hard plate with support curtain it is soft Property cloth, the flexible cloth, hard plate and support curtain formed packing bag bag chamber, be fixed between support curtain and the hard plate Hard plate is limited towards the movement of support curtain and detachable support rod.
Be similar to above-mentioned vertical greening device in the prior art, the mode directly fallen down from above on greening wall into Row pours;The mode of this pouring, the first plant of lower layer may be blocked by the plant on upper layer, the moisture for causing plant to receive Unevenness, therefore need to pour a large amount of water every time and guarantee that the plant of lower layer has water pouring;Secondly it is just needed every the shorter time It pours once, pouring is more troublesome.

Embodiment, a kind of water recycle vertical greening, as shown in Figure 1, include greening wall 1, be set to it is several on greening wall 1 Plant module 2 and water circulation system 3.
As shown in Figure 1, water circulation system 3 includes the catch basin 4 for being set to 1 bottom of greening wall, one end connection storage of water inlet The watering pipeline 6 that water pump 5, one end connection water pump 5 in sink 4 are discharged one end connects the other end of watering pipeline 6 with one end Water return pipeline 7.Watering pipeline 6 is vertically arranged at the side of greening wall 1;Water return pipeline 7 is snakelike in from top to bottom, and return pipe The end on road 7 is placed in 4 top of catch basin.Specifically, water return pipeline 7 includes several horizontal sinks being intervally arranged along the vertical direction 8 and be cross-linked adjacent level sink 8 close on 6 one end of watering pipeline or far from 6 one end of watering pipeline connecting tube 9.Cause The recirculated water of this catch basin 4 is moved to the upside of greening wall 1 through watering pipeline 6, then through return water under the power that water pump 5 provides Horizontal sink 8 on pipeline 7 layer by layer gradually moves down, and finally returns to catch basin 4.
As shown in Figure 1, plantation module 2 is uniformly distributed between adjacent horizontal sink 8.In the present embodiment, every group adjacent Horizontal sink 8 between be provided with three groups of plantation modules 2.
Specifically, in conjunction with shown in Fig. 2,3, plantation module 2 include the planting pot 10 being fixedly installed on 1 side wall of greening wall, It is opened in water storage cavity 11 corresponding with 10 position of planting pot in greening wall 1.Water storage cavity 11 is opened in planting pot 10 in the present embodiment Lower section.The side towards greening wall 1 of planting pot 10 offers water suction entrance 12, and water suction entrance 12 is connected with water storage cavity 11 It is logical;And it is provided with the absorbent cotton sliver 13 that water suction entrance 12 protrudes into water storage cavity 11 in planting pot 10, has when in water storage cavity 11 When water, absorbent cotton sliver 13 can keep the water in planting pot 10 in the storage water constant absorption to planting pot 10 of water storage cavity 11 Point;The part of the access water suction entrance 12 of absorbent cotton sliver 13 can be arranged silicone tube 31, protect absorbent cotton sliver 13.Absorbent cotton sliver 13 Tail portion can install clump weight 30, so that absorbing the case where sliver 13 is less prone to bending.
Further, the height of the horizontal sink 8 of the correspondence of water storage cavity 11 offers water supplement port 14;When recirculated water is by horizontal When sink 8, the recirculated water in horizontal sink 8 will be entered in water storage cavity 11 by water supplement port 14, be 11 moisturizing of water storage cavity.And it is It avoids impurity from entering in water storage cavity 11, on water supplement port 14 is equipped with filter screen 15.
In the present embodiment, as shown in figure 4, vertical adjacent plantation module 2 is staggered on horizontal position, to reduce greening Wall 1 goes up the quantity of water storage cavity 11 in the same vertical position, so that greening wall 1 is whole to be able to maintain higher intensity.
Further, as shown in Figure 4,5, cleaning pipeline 16 is provided in greening wall 1.Clearing up pipeline 16 has multiple beginnings With an end, the beginning for clearing up pipeline 16 is separately connected the bottom of water storage cavity 11, and the end of cleaning pipeline 16 is connected to water storage 4 top of slot.Specifically, being provided with channel switch between the beginning of cleaning pipeline 16 and the bottom of water storage cavity 11.Channel switch packet The slideway 18 for being set to 11 bottom of water storage cavity and the baffle 19 that is connected in slideway 18 of sliding are included, and successively one between adjacent screen Body connects and composes linkage board 21;Linkage board 21 offers the switch hole 20 of connection water storage cavity 11, linkage board 21 on along its length By sliding isolation or connection water storage cavity 11 and cleaning pipeline 16, switch is realized.In addition to lift-off seal, water storage cavity 11 Side towards linkage board 21 is provided with sealing ring(It is not shown in the figure).
Specifically, as shown in figure 4, one end of linkage board 21 is stretched out out of cleaning pipeline 16, in the drive one of linkage board 21 Under, switch hole 20 being capable of synchronizing moving.Greening wall 1 is provided on the side side wall that linkage board 21 stretches out and is sequentially connected linkage board 21 vertical yoke plate 22 can lead 21 synchronization-sliding of linkage board under the drive of vertical yoke plate 22.In addition to convenient vertical Yoke plate 22 slides relative to greening wall 1, and the driving assembly for driving vertical yoke plate 22 to slide is provided on greening wall 1.
Specifically, as shown in fig. 6, driving assembly is set to the middle part of 1 short transverse of greening wall.Driving assembly includes rotation The screw rod 23 being connected on greening wall 1 and the handwheel 24 for being fixedly connected on 23 outer end of screw rod, and offer and match on vertical yoke plate 22 Together in the threaded hole of screw rod 23.By rotating handwheel 24, the upper sliding in the horizontal direction of vertical yoke plate 22 is driven, is opened with reaching to synchronize Close the effect of all channel switch.
Therefore when needing to clear up water storage cavity 11, by opening water pump 5 and channel switch, so that recirculated water is from water supplement port 14 Into in water storage cavity 11, existing impurity can be along cleaning channel together under the drive of recirculated water in water storage cavity 11 It is expelled back into catch basin 4.
The bottom of horizontal sink 8 is provided with water pipe for drip irrigation 25, and sets in the middle part of side of the horizontal sink 8 far from greening wall 1 It is equipped with connection or completely cuts off the trickle irrigation switch member of water pipe for drip irrigation 25;The bottom of water pipe for drip irrigation 25 corresponds to the top of 10 position of planting pot It is provided with the trickle irrigation mouth 26 for trickle irrigation planting pot 10.Recirculated water energy when trickle irrigation switch member is opened, in horizontal sink 8 It is entered in water pipe for drip irrigation 25 by trickle irrigation switch member, is then that planting pot 10 carries out trickle irrigation by trickle irrigation mouth 26.
Trickle irrigation switch member uses solenoid valve 17, automatically controlled control in the present embodiment.In addition it prevents from storing in water pipe for drip irrigation 25 More recirculated water.Water pipe for drip irrigation 25 extends horizontally to 9 side of connecting tube and forms overflow port 27.Can be set on overflow port 27 so that The check valve that water pipe for drip irrigation 25 is flowed to 9 direction of connecting tube.
Specifically, catch basin 4 includes water inlet side and water outlet side, water pump 5 and watering pipeline 6 are set to water outlet side, and clear up Recirculated water is oriented to water inlet side by the end of pipeline 16 and the end of water return pipeline.Catch basin 4 be provided with separate water inlet side and The impurity of filtering water inlet side in water is avoided the impurity of water inlet side from entering by the screen pack 28 of water outlet side, screen pack 28 Water outlet side impacts water pump 5.
In addition it is worth one, returns to Fig. 3, in the present embodiment, horizontal sink 8 includes the trough floor of convex on middle part 29.Convex arc has the function of to guide water flow to two sides in horizontal sink 8, therefore in recirculated water in horizontal sink It in 8 during flowing, is easier to flow to water supplement port 14 to be 11 moisturizing of water storage cavity, is also easier to flow to solenoid valve 17 to be water pipe for drip irrigation 25 Moisturizing.
To sum up, in the present embodiment, the corresponding water storage cavity 11 of each planting pot 10, absorbent cotton sliver 13 connects 11 He of water storage cavity Planting pot 10.When having water in water storage cavity 11, absorbent cotton sliver 13 can be delivered to the water in water storage cavity 11 is lasting In planting pot 10.Guarantee persistently to supply water for planting pot 10.And when water is inadequate in water storage cavity 11, pass through water circulation system 3 Middle water pump 5 is provided under power, and it is 11 moisturizing of water storage cavity that water flow, which successively passes through watering pipeline 6, return pipe, water supplement port 14,.Compared to Existing pouring mode can continue the mode for drawing water in water storage cavity 11 using absorbent cotton sliver 13, once fill water storage cavity After 11, it is not necessarily to moisturizing in long period of time, to extend the period for needing moisturizing, reduces the cost needed for pouring.And It, can be by opening solenoid valve 17, so that circulation when needing more rapidly to be watered for the plant in planting pot 10 It when water is entered in horizontal sink 8, can enter in water pipe for drip irrigation 25, plant carries out trickle irrigation, and the mode of trickle irrigation is compared to water suction Sliver 13 absorbs the mode of water, can more quickly be plant moisturizing.
